Briefing — Leadership Review: Currency Hedging

For the incoming director: Ostrevane Group currently hedges 60% of projected Solmark-denominated receivables on a rolling six-month basis. Treasury recommends extending cover to nine months given volatility in the Varenne corridor. Cost of the extended programme is within the approved risk budget. The committee deferred a final decision pending your arrival. Last quarter's unhedged exposure cost roughly 1.4% of export revenue. The confidential planning note follows directly below.

board note of tawip-hahip: Only 7 of the 80 pilot accounts renewed Ralath, so a churn review is set for April 1.

## Ticket-Pricing Experiment — Quotas (Farrowgate Box Office)

The Farrowgate pricing experiment adjusts ticket prices within guardrails on a subset of events. If the experiment service is unreachable, checkout falls back to list price — this is expected and not page-worthy on its own. Page only if the fallback rate breaches the alert threshold for a sustained window, since that usually means the bandit worker is wedged. Price deltas are clamped both per-ticket and per-order. The active guardrail constants are shown below.

tuning table, yajog-yahof:
BUDGETS = {
    "lamvan": 303,
    "wenox": 460,
    "fenvan": 525,
}

Handover: fan-out backpressure in NudgePipe

Quick notes for plugin authors picking this up. The notification fan-out now applies token-bucket backpressure per channel, so your plugin should expect occasional 'deferred' responses instead of hard failures — just honor the retry hint. Don't bypass the queue with direct sends; that's what caused the Larkfield incident. The batching knobs live in the dispatcher config. Going forward, the person responsible for this subsystem is named below.

approver of bagug-bagag = Holael Pramir